CRCP制动板锚固强度影响因素分析与结构设计

摘    要:制动板端部锚固强度的影响因素主要有端部锚固力、制动板长度、混凝土弹性模量、基层弹性模量、路基回弹模量等,用有限元分析软件ANSYS,从这5个方面分析计算了端部制动板锚固系统的位移和最大应力,得出了各影响因素对端部制动板锚固强度的影响规律,提出了适合不同工程条件下制动板类型。

关 键 词:连续配筋混凝土路面  变形  有限元  端部制动板锚固

Abstract:Influencing factors on the anchorage strength of the end of brake plate are the end anchorage force,the length of the brake plate,the elastic modulus of concrete,the grass-roots elastic modulus,the subgrade resilient modulus.The displacement and maximum stress of the brake plate anchor system were analyzed with the finite element software ANSYS from the five aspects.The effect of the five influencing factors to the strength of the end of brake plate is obtained.And the types under the different projects conditions of the brake plate are put forward.
Keywords:CRCP  deformation  ANSYS  brake plate end anchorage
